Superman (Volume 4) #37 is an issue of the series Superman (Volume 4) with a cover date of February, 2018. It was published on December 20, 2017.

Synopsis for "Super Sons of Tomorrow, Part 1: Dark of the Son"
Bruce Wayne is calmly reading a book within the library of Wayne Manor, until all of a sudden, a mysterious figure crashes through a window and attacks him. It is an adult Tim Drake, who has become the Batman of an alternate timeline. He wants to save the timeline from some kind of danger but needs Bruce's resources to do it, but Bruce, aware that Tim's plan involves killing innocent people, cannot let Tim go unopposed. Their brawl spans all over the Manor, with both fighters throwing punches and various objects at each other. Bruce drops a chandelier on top of Tim, temporarily immobilizing him, but Tim draws his gun and shoots his former mentor. The gunshot does not kill Bruce, however, as Tim needs him to enter the Batcave. Once there, Tim finds a chamber with boxes that contain weapons tailored to the weaknesses of Bruce's fellow superheroes.
Meanwhile, at the Arctic, Superman has dedicated himself to repairing the Fortress of Solitude after his confrontation with Mr. Oz. While fixing the statues of his deceased parents, Superman gets a warning from Kelex that an intruder is approaching the Fortress. Tim has arrived. Superman, aware that the Batman he knows would never use guns, concludes that the intruder is Tim Drake from another timeline. Tim says that he is on a mission, one that Superman cannot interfere with. Even so, Tim cannot risk killing Superman, as the Man of Steel's presence in this timeline keeps it safe. He only came to the Fortress to prevent Superman from interfering in his task.
Tim uses a smoke cloud to disorient Superman and activate a Kryptonian battle armor in order to even the odds. Despite some initial trouble, Superman neutralizes the armor and throws Tim into the snow outside the Fortress. Unfortunately, Superman springs Tim's final trap, a special cage made of Red Kryptonite, which slowly drains Superman's powers. Tim says that Superman cannot interfere in his mission: to save the timeline, he must kill Superboy.
